Maintaining a flawless complexion requires more than just good genes—it demands a consistent skincare practice. The skin, being the body’s largest organ, it encounters various external pollutants, UV rays, and multiple factors that affect its condition. A structured regimen featuring cleansing, hydration, treatment masks, serums, and pure oils is essential for maintaining skin that remains youthful and resilient.
Washing the face every day is the basis for a successful beauty regimen. Throughout the day, the surface gathers dirt, sebum, and pollutants, if left unchecked, can lead to clogged pores, lack of radiance, and dermatological problems. Cleansing eliminates these impurities, making sure a clean facial area. However, it’s crucial to use a mild face wash appropriate for one’s skin type to prevent over-drying. Harsh products can deplete the skin’s protective barrier, causing inflammation. Sensitive skin types should opt get more info for fragrance-free options. Those with excess sebum should consider gel-based washes that provide balance without excessive dryness. Hydrating cream-based cleansers work best for dry skin, ensuring hydration while cleansing.
After washing, hydration is the next crucial step in any skincare routine. Moisturizers serve to replenish hydration, preventing dehydration or sensitivity. No matter your skin type, moisturization is beneficial. People dealing with acne can opt for gel-based moisturizers that provide hydration without clogging pores. Dehydrated skin types, an intense moisture-locking product is more effective. Combination skin requires a mix of textures to prevent excess shine and flaking. Over time, a good moisturizer helps keep soft, radiant texture.
Pure oils have gained popularity because they provide deep hydration. Unlike conventional moisturizers, natural oils sink in quickly to provide skin barrier support. Ingredients such as rosehip oil, packed with antioxidants, help to repair. For individuals with excessive sebum, non-comedogenic options such as squalane moisturize without clogging pores. Dry or mature skin types need deeply hydrating oils like moringa, to combat fine lines. Incorporating a facial oil as a final step ensures a radiant glow, giving a luminous appearance.
